Popular Custom Design Trends

As trends continue to evolve, several custom engagement ring styles are capturing attention. Below are some of the most sought-after design trends:

Trend Description
Vintage-Inspired Designs featuring intricate detailing that recalls classic styles from past decades.
Geometric Shapes Rings with modern lines and unique shapes, offering a contemporary aesthetic.
Mixed Metals Combining various metal types, such as rose gold and platinum, for a striking contrast.
Bold Gemstones Using unconventional gemstones such as sapphires, emeralds, or unique colored diamonds.
Nature-Inspired Designs Rings that incorporate motifs from nature, like floral designs and organic shapes.

The Customization Process

The journey to obtain a custom engagement ring is as special as the ring itself. Here's how the typical customization process unfolds:

  1. Design Consultation: Couples discuss their vision with a jewelry designer to explore ideas, styles, and options.
  2. Materials Selection: Choosing the right gemstones and metals is crucial, considering both aesthetic and ethical implications.
  3. Sketch or CAD Model: The designer provides a sketch or a computer-generated model for approval.
  4. Production: Once the design is finalized, the crafting process begins, transforming ideas into a tangible ring.
  5. Final Review: The finished ring is presented for final approval before it is delivered.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

As the interest in custom engagement rings grows, several questions often arise. Here are some common inquiries:

What is the average cost of a custom engagement ring?

The cost can vary significantly based on the materials, design complexity, and brand reputation. Typically, custom rings can start from a moderate price point and go up into the luxury range.

How long does it take to create a custom ring?

The customization process can take anywhere from a few weeks to a few months. It mainly depends on the design intricacies and the jeweler’s workload.

Can I make changes to the design during the process?

Most jewelers allow for adjustments up until the production starts. Typically, there are opportunities to refine the design during the consultation phase.
